Startlister
In the men’s field, the favorite to win will be the Kenyan athlete, Kibiwott Kandie, who holds the second-best time in the world in half-marathon (57:32′) and who has won the 2020, 2022 and 2023 editions of the Valencia half-marathon. Likewise, four more athletes from Kenya and one from Tanzania, all with times under one hour, are aiming for the podium. Kandie’s direct competitor will be his compatriot Philemon Kiplimo, with a fifth position and personal best of 58:11′ in the Valencia Half-Marathon 2020, who will also participate in the Zurich Marató Barcelona 2024. He will be closely followed by his compatriots Mathew Kimeli, with a best time of 58:43′ at the Valencia 2021 Half-Marathon, Hillary Kipkoech, ninth at the last edition of the Valencian half-marathon, where he achieved his best time over this distance (59:22′) and Peter Mwaniki, third at the 10K of Valencia this January (26:59’). As well, it will come the Tanzanian Gabriel Gerald Geay, who achieved his personal best in the Houston half-marathon in 2020 (59:42), and the Swedish Andreas Almgren, who got the national record also at the 10K of Valencia last month (27:20’).
For their part, in the women’s category, there will be an athlete who will fight to get back on the podium, but this time she will try to climb the highest stage: Joyciline Jepkosgei. This athlete, also from Kenya, was second in the Barcelona’s Half Marathon in 2023 (01:04:46h), followed by the Kenyan Gladys Chepkurui, fourth in the Barcelona’s Half Marathon in 2023 (01:05:46h) and the Ethiopian Senbere Teferi, winner of the Valencia’s Half Marathon in 2019 (01:05:32h). It is also worth mentioning England’s Jessica Warner-Judd, who will prepare in Barcelona for her participation in the Paris 2024 Olympic Games.
